Transaction 1646f0e5ae94bb2fe2fa20671312680d6455b65664e26b03cb8de0cf3d2dced9

200 Input
1 Outputs
  • 1646f0e5ae94bb2fe2fa20671312680d6455b65664e26b03cb8de0cf3d2dced9:0
  • value  34431687
    address  38Ha2ZfVDnAtwcXdgpJMQSnkqJHDhVyQu5